PRODUCT STRATEGY
Merit Launches Great Skin Double Cleanse
MERIT’s bi-phase cleanser fuses makeup removal, exfoliation, and wash into one SKU, answering demand for simplified routines and giving retailers a margin-friendly alternative to multi-step regimens.

EcoLux pairs a 100% PP recyclable dropper with a heavy glass bottle, giving prestige skincare a compliant path as EPR laws tighten and consumers spot greenwashing faster than ever.

SPORTS INFLUENCER MARKETING
E.l.f. Cosmetics Signs Four NWSL Athletes
The brand’s multi-year deal with Barcenas, Dahlkemper, LaBonta, and Shaw extends its NWSL partnership, tapping surging women’s sports fandom to diversify creator spend beyond beauty-native channels.

⚡QUICK READS

Skinceuticals Adds A.G.E. Interrupter Ultra Serum: L’Oréal’s derm-doctor label pushes a 34.6% actives cocktail that claims 18% lift in 12 weeks, fuelling the clinical efficacy arms race. (More)

Martha Stewart Unveils Elm Biosciences: An 84-year-old icon joins the longevity skincare game with a serum-plus-supplement duo co-created by dermatologist Dhaval Bhanusali. (More)

Squishmallows Makeup Lands at Ulta: Toy-to-cosmetics crossover debuts via SNAPBRANDS, aiming at Gen-Z wallets with tactile packaging and cruelty-free formulas.(More)
